What Is ADA Parking Lot Compliance?

The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) established accessibility standards designed to ensure individuals with disabilities have equal access to public facilities and commercial properties.

One important component of these standards involves parking facilities.

ADA-compliant parking lots generally include:

  • Designated accessible parking spaces
  • Proper access aisles
  • Accessible routes to building entrances
  • Appropriate signage
  • Clearly visible pavement markings
  • Adequate space dimensions

The goal is to create parking areas that are safe, functional, and accessible for all visitors.

Common ADA Compliance Issues Found in Parking Lots

Many parking lots begin as compliant facilities but gradually fall out of compliance over time.

Several issues are frequently encountered throughout Brevard County.

Faded Pavement Markings

Florida's intense sunlight and frequent rainfall can cause ADA markings to fade.

When markings become difficult to see, accessible spaces may not remain clearly identifiable.

Missing or Damaged Signage

Parking signs can become damaged, removed, or obscured over time.

Worn Access Aisles

Access aisles must remain clearly marked and visible.

Faded striping can reduce effectiveness and create confusion.

Parking Lot Modifications

Property improvements and parking lot changes can unintentionally affect accessibility layouts.

Lack of Ongoing Maintenance

Many property owners simply fail to reevaluate parking lots after initial construction.

Regular inspections help identify concerns before they become larger issues.

Why Florida Parking Lots Require Regular ADA Evaluations

Brevard County's climate accelerates wear on pavement markings.

UV Exposure

The Florida sun gradually fades striping and pavement symbols.

Heavy Rainfall

Rain contributes to wear and visibility loss.

Traffic Wear

Vehicles constantly driving over parking spaces reduce marking visibility over time.

Sealcoating Projects

Parking lots often require restriping after sealcoating to maintain compliance.

Routine evaluations help property owners identify these issues before they impact accessibility.
